AP Italian Language and Culture focuses on six themes: personal and public identities, family and communities, global challenges, personal and public entertainments, family and communities, and beauty and aesthetics. The exam tests your ability to understand spoken and written Italian, as well as produce written and spoken responses on these topics. You'll need to demonstrate cultural knowledge about Italian-speaking communities alongside language proficiency.
The exam is divided into two sections: Multiple Choice (listening and reading comprehension) and Free Response (writing and speaking). The multiple-choice section tests your comprehension skills, while the free-response section requires you to write emails, essays, and participate in simulated conversations. Understanding each section's format and timing requirements is essential for performing well on test day.

Many students struggle with the speaking section, since it requires real-time conversation skills and cultural knowledge without preparation time. Others find the listening comprehension challenging due to the variety of accents and conversational pace. Additionally, writing essays that demonstrate cultural understanding while maintaining grammatical accuracy is a common pain point. Personalized tutoring helps you practice these specific skills with targeted feedback.

Most students benefit from starting preparation 3-4 months before the exam if they're already intermediate speakers, or 6+ months if they're building from a beginner level. The FSI estimates that reaching professional proficiency in Italian requires around 600 hours of study, though AP Italian requires a more focused skill set. Practice tests are crucial because they help you understand the exam's pacing, question formats, and what to expect on test day. Taking full-length practice exams under timed conditions reveals which sections need more work and helps reduce test anxiety. Expert tutors use practice test results to identify patterns in your mistakes and adjust your study plan accordingly, ensuring you're focusing on areas that will have the biggest impact on your score.
